History of Romaine Lettuce Outbreaks
Romaine lettuce has been implicated in several foodborne illness outbreaks in the United States and other countries. One of the most significant outbreaks occurred in 2018, when contaminated romaine lettuce from the Yuma, Arizona, growing region was linked to a multistate outbreak of E. coli O157:H7 infections. The outbreak resulted in 197 reported cases of illness, including five deaths, across 35 states.
Another notable outbreak occurred in 2019, when romaine lettuce from the Salinas, California, growing region was contaminated with E. coli O157:H7. This outbreak led to 167 reported cases of illness, including three deaths, across 27 states. These outbreaks highlighted the need for increased vigilance and improved safety protocols in the production and handling of romaine lettuce.

What Caused the Romaine Lettuce Recalls?
The recalls of romaine lettuce in previous years were primarily caused by contamination with Shiga toxin-producing E. coli (STEC), a type of bacteria that can cause severe foodborne illness. The contamination was often linked to factors such as irrigation water quality, proximity to cattle farms (which can be a source of E. coli), and poor sanitation practices during harvesting and processing. In some cases, the exact source of contamination was difficult to pinpoint, highlighting the complexity of tracing the origin of produce in the food supply chain.

What Are the Symptoms of E. coli Infection from Romaine Lettuce?
The symptoms of an E. coli infection from consuming contaminated romaine lettuce can vary in severity but typically include severe diarrhea, often bloody, and abdominal cramps. In some cases, individuals may also experience vomiting, and in severe infections, life-threatening complications such as hemolytic uremic syndrome (HUS) can occur. HUS is a type of kidney failure that can lead to serious health issues, especially in vulnerable populations like the elderly, young children, and people with compromised immune systems. It’s crucial for individuals who experience any of these symptoms after consuming romaine lettuce to seek medical attention promptly.
Early recognition and treatment of E. coli infection can significantly improve outcomes and reduce the risk of long-term health consequences. Healthcare providers may prescribe supportive care, such as hydration and rest, and in some cases, may recommend further testing or treatment. How Do I Handle Romaine Lettuce Safely at Home?
Handling romaine lettuce safely at home involves several steps to minimize the risk of contamination. First, choose lettuce that looks fresh and has no signs of spoilage. Always wash your hands before and after handling lettuce. Then, rinse the lettuce under running water to remove any visible dirt or debris. It’s also recommended to dry the lettuce with a clean towel or salad spinner to prevent moisture from contributing to bacterial growth. Store lettuce in a sealed container at a consistent refrigerator temperature below 40°F (4°C) to inhibit bacterial proliferation.
Additionally, prevent cross-contamination by keeping raw lettuce separate from ready-to-eat foods and using separate cutting boards and utensils for handling lettuce. Regularly clean and sanitize any surfaces or utensils that come into contact with lettuce to remove any potential bacteria.
